Blotter: Facial Cream Theft at Costco

The following information was supplied by the South San Francisco Police Department. Where arrests or charges are mentioned, it does not indicate a conviction.

Monday, January 30

10:35am Police sent a unit to Costco on El Camino Real, where a subject was in custody for attempting to steal $146 worth of facial cream.

11:57am  Officers received a report from Junipero Serra near Hickey Boulevard that a female subject ran out of a cab without paying the fare, and that the woman’s husband then drove her away from the scene in a gold Land Rover.

1:54pm  A Ford Mustang convertible was reported as stolen from the Alida Apartments on Alida Way sometime during the morning.

6:49pm  The window of a vehicle parked at Hungry Hunter on South Airport Boulevard was broken and a purse was reportedly stolen from inside.

8:52pm  Officers sent a unit to 7-Eleven on Callan Boulevard, where a man had reportedly opened two cans of beer in the store, drank them and left without paying.

9:26pm  A purse was reportedly stolen out of a black Chevy Equinox parked at Chevy’s on Hickey Boulevard.

Tuesday, January 31

10:29am  Officers received a report from a man who said that he had been while at home on Kenry Way by a man pretending to be a FedEx delivery man.

1:42pm  Police responded to the scene of a four-car pileup Avalon Drive and Junipero Serra.

2:04pm  A guest at Citigarden Inn on South Airport Boulevard reportedly approached the front desk, stole a radio and then left in a silver Honda Civic.
